21 .Nd gotwebd configuration file
24 is the run-time configuration file for
27 The file format is line-based, with one configuration directive per line.
28 Any lines beginning with a
30 are treated as comments and ignored.
32 Macros can be defined that are later expanded in context.
33 Macro names must start with a letter, digit, or underscore, and may
34 contain any of those characters, but may not be reserved words.
35 Macros are not expanded inside quotes.

50 .Sh GLOBAL CONFIGURATION
51 The available global configuration directives are as follows:
61 .It Ic prefork Ar number
62 Run the specified number of server processes.
63 .It Ic unix_socket Ar on | off
64 Controls whether the servers will listen on unix sockets by default.
65 .It Ic unix_socket_name Ar path
66 Set the path to the default unix socket.

91 The available server configuration directives are as follows:
93 .It Ic custom_css Ar path
94 Set the path to a custom Cascading Style Sheet (CSS) to be used.
95 If this option is not specified then a default style sheet will be used.
96 .It Ic listen on Ar address Ic port Ar number
97 Configure an address and port for incoming FCGI TCP connections.

120 .It Ic logo_url Ar url
121 Set a hyperlink for the logo.
122 .It Ic max_commits_display Ar number
123 Set the maximum amount of commits displayed per page.
124 .It Ic max_repos Ar number
125 Set the maximum amount of repositories
128 .It Ic max_repos_display Ar number
129 Set the maximum amount of repositories displayed on the index screen.
130 .It Ic repos_path Ar path
131 Set the path to the directory which contains Git repositories that
132 the server should publish.
133 .It Ic respect_exportok Ar on | off
134 Set whether to display the repository only if it contains the magic
135 .Pa git-daemon-export-ok
137 .It Ic show_repo_age Ar on | off
138 Toggle display of last repository modification date.
139 .It Ic show_repo_cloneurl Ar on | off
140 Toggle display of clone URLs for a repository.
141 This requires the creation of a
143 file inside the repository which contains one URL per line.
144 .It Ic show_repo_description Ar on | off
145 Toggle display of the repository description.
148 file in the repository should be updated with an appropriate description.
149 .It Ic show_repo_owner Ar on | off
150 Set whether to display the repository owner.
